Motor protection circuit Order code Rated and Short circuit Qty Wt General characteristics
magnetic breaking per SM1RM… are motor protection circuit breakers with
breakers SM1RM… trip current capacity pkg magnetic tripping only and high breaking capacity.
up to 40A. at 400V They are typically used to protect starters where there is a
thermal relay or other overload protection.

SM1PF... circuit breakers Order code Fixed Short circuit Qty Wt General characteristics
thermal breaking per SM1PF… are breakers with magnetic-thermal tripping
Fuse monitoring function release capacity pkg intended specifically for monitoring the status of fuses.
current at 400V By connecting every phase of the breaker to a fuse, when it
Icu Ics blows, the motor protection breaks.
Through the auxiliary contacts fitted on the motor
[A] [kA] [kA] n° [kg] protection, the blown fuses are signalled electrically.
